Carey Mulligan and Nicolas Winding Refn talk Drive as Red Band Trailer is Released


22 July 2011

Carey Mulligan took part in a panel discussion about her latest film, Drive at Comic Con 2011 yesterday in San Diego,.

The 26-year-old English actress wore a silk mink, tangerine and navy color block cut out dress from Roksanda Ilincic's Resort 2012 collection to the event, which also featured director Nicolas Winding Refn and Carey's co-star, Ron Perlman.

Sadly Ryan Gosling wasn't there to promote the film. He was over in New York with Emma Stone and Steve Carell at the Crazy, Stupid, Love press junket.

Also yesterday, the red band trailer for the film was released. It teases how brutal Ryan Gosling can be in his lead role as a Hollywood stunt driver by day and a getaway driver by night.

Director Refn recalled his first meeting with Gosling. "I was completely out of it after taking American drugs and couldn't really talk to him properly when I met him at his restaurant," he said. "I eventually asked him to drive me home because I couldn't face getting a cab."

"We got into the car to drive to Santa Monica, turned on the radio and it was Reo Speedwagon playing 'Can't Fight This Feeling'! I started singing along to it, badly, and also crying," he continued. "Then I just screamed, 'I got it! I know what 'Drive' is! It's a man who drives around at night listening to pop music and that's his emotional release!' "

Drive will be released in Cinemas on September 23rd.
